1. A security system comprising:

  • a structure having a structural surface, the structure sized to contain an asset therein and configured to provide a forceful breaching delay;

    the structure having an opening formed therein to permit predetermined access to the asset contained within the structure; and

    the structure including intrusion detection features within or associated with the structure that are activated in response to at least a partial breach of the structure;

    wherein the structure comprises interconnected structural members; and

    wherein the intrusion detection features include a strand of flexible material extending within at least one interconnected edge member, opposed ends of the strand received by an interface component;

    sufficient damage to the strand as sensed by the interface component resulting in generation of an alarm signal corresponding to at least a partial breach of the structure; and

    wherein the at least one interconnected edge member at least partially defines at least one interconnected structural member comprising an opening.
